BMW 328IC Filters
The BMW 328iC comes with a series of required filters, including an engine oil filter that is essential as it eliminates contaminants from the engine oil for optimum performance. The air filter also keeps dirt and debris from getting into the engine's air intake system, thus ensuring effective combustion. A cabin air filter is installed to improve the air quality inside the car, working assiduously to strain out pollutants and allergens. The fuel filter has an important function, as it protects the fuel system by trapping the impurities in the gasoline. The transmission filter has the job of removing particles and debris from the transmission fluid, thus guaranteeing the smooth performance and long life of the transmission system.
Typical Lifespan of BMW 328IC Filters
The BMW 328iC engine air filter normally lasts for approximately 30,000 miles when driven normally. For optimal air quality within the vehicle, the cabin air filter is normally changed every 15,000 to 20,000 miles. The oil filter, however, must be replaced with each oil change, which is advisable to be done every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, depending on driving conditions and driving style. Here, the fuel filter itself will last for around 60,000 to 100,000 miles, with some circumstances requiring it to be replaced sooner, depending on the quality of the fuel and the manner in which it is being used. In addition to this, the transmission filter needs to be looked at and, as required, replaced every 30,000 to 60,000 miles if the car faces excessive use or abusive environments.
Signs to Replace BMW 328IC Filters
In a BMW 328i Convertible, a dirty or clogged engine air filter can cause decreased acceleration and engine performance. A cabin air filter that should be replaced usually causes diminished airflow from the vents and a moldy smell in the car. If the oil filter needs to be replaced, the engine will experience loss of efficiency, and you may hear strange noises or the dreaded glow of the oil light warning. A clogged fuel filter can cause a car not to start, idle roughly, or stall without warning. In addition, a worn transmission filter could lead to the transmission slipping, a lag in engaging the gears, or strange noises upon shifting.
